The most commonly used roof pitches fall in a range between 4 12 and 9 12.
Pitches above 9 12 are very highly angled and are designated steep slope roofs.
Pitches lower than 4 12 have a slight angle and they are defined as low slope roofs.
A common house roof pitch is 5 by 12 which means it slopes up from the wall at 5 inches per foot.
